We were able to get an aerial photo of the proposed project site, and took it to the architect, Hite and Associates. We will be working with Brad Williams at the Hite office. Mrs. Connell explained her project to him, noting the 10 stations planned for the site, as well as the paving and the fossil reject pit. Mr. Williams has agreed to produce the plans at no cost, and has completed the preliminary plans for our review. I will post the plans on your ECCA bulletin board for your review and comments when I get our copy.
Mrs. Connell has applied for several grants and should begin hearing from them beginning this month.
Our next project meeting will be Monday, November 19th, the evening we return from the CAT trip. We will be meeting with the Pitt County Board of Education to present the project and get the Board's approval to proceed. This should just be a formality, but a necessary one. First Planning Meeting
On October 11, 2007, we held our first official planning meeting at NW Elementary. We met with Mrs. Hilda Connell, Assistant Principal, and Ty Nelson, PE Teacher, to share ideas and discuss how to proceed.
We will also be planning a playground for the center of the track. While we will not be focusing on this portion of the project at first, we are going to begin coming up with ideas and meeting with some of the students at the school to talk with them about what their ideas are and what they want to see in their playground. Below is a photo of the current playground equipment at the school...
We are going to begin with working to find a way to pave the walking trail with asphalt. The Construction Management faculty are going to talk with some CMGT Advisory Board members who work for contractors that do asphalt work to see if they would be interested in helping out. We are hoping to get this portion of the project donated or for a discounted price. Below are a few pictures of the track...
Above: The group takes a look at the track. It is a gravel trail that is overgrown with grass and weeds.
Left: Dr. Erich Connell walks around the track to do some investigative work
After the track is surfaced we will begin to work on the exercise stations around the track. We discussed at the meeting about doing four stations the children and adults will be able to use. We may be able to expand this and construct more stations, but we have to wait and see what kind of funding will be available.
